LM358WPT Equivalent & Substitute Parts
Part Overview
The LM358WPT is a general-purpose operational amplifier featuring two independent circuits in an 8-TSSOP surface mount package, manufactured by Rohm Semiconductor. This device operates across a wide supply voltage range of 3V to 32V and is suitable for applications requiring dual-channel amplification with moderate bandwidth requirements.
The LM358WPT carries a product status of "Not For New Designs," indicating that while the device remains available in inventory (2300 pcs), it is no longer recommended for new circuit development. This status necessitates identification of equivalent and substitute parts that maintain functional compatibility while offering active product status or enhanced performance characteristics.

Substitute Part Grouping Explanation
Substitution of the LM358WPT is determined by compatibility across the following critical parameters:
Package and Pinout Compatibility: All substitute parts must utilize the 8-TSSOP surface mount package with identical 0.173" (4.40mm) width to ensure direct PCB footprint compatibility.
Dual-Circuit Configuration: All substitutes maintain the two independent operational amplifier circuits required for dual-channel applications.
Supply Voltage Range: Substitute parts must support the minimum 3V supply requirement. The LM358WPT maximum of 32V establishes an upper boundary; substitutes with lower maximum ratings (30V) remain compatible for applications not exceeding 30V operation.
Input Bias Current: The 20 nA specification is maintained across all general-purpose substitute options, ensuring equivalent input impedance characteristics.
Voltage Input Offset: Substitutes with input offset specifications of 1mV to 5mV remain functionally compatible, as these variations fall within typical application tolerances.
Output Current Capability: The 30mA per-channel specification of the LM358WPT is met or exceeded by substitute parts rated at 40mA or 60mA per channel.
Slew Rate and Bandwidth: The LM358WPT operates at 0.3V/µs slew rate and 800kHz gain-bandwidth product. Substitute parts with equal or superior performance (higher slew rate, higher bandwidth) provide enhanced frequency response while maintaining backward compatibility.
Temperature Range: Operating temperature ranges of -40°C to 85°C (LM358WPT) through -40°C to 125°C (extended range substitutes) are compatible for applications within the LM358WPT's specified range.

Engineering Selection Recommendations
Direct Functional Replacement (Identical Electrical Performance):
The LM2904PT (Rohm Semiconductor, Active status) provides direct functional equivalence to the LM358WPT. Both devices share identical electrical specifications: 0.3V/µs slew rate, 800kHz gain-bandwidth product, 1mV input offset voltage, and 30mA output current per channel. The LM2904PT extends the operating temperature range to -40°C to 125°C and maintains active product status, making it the primary recommendation for new designs requiring the LM358WPT's performance profile.
Enhanced Performance Substitutes (Higher Bandwidth and Slew Rate):
The LM258 series (LM258PT, LM258WPT, LM258WYPT, LM258YPT, LM258APT) from STMicroelectronics offers improved performance with 0.6V/µs slew rate and 1.1MHz gain-bandwidth product while maintaining the same 20nA input bias current and 8-TSSOP package. These devices carry active product status and AEC-Q100 automotive qualification. The LM258WPT and LM258WYPT variants provide the lowest input offset voltage (2mV) and highest output current (60mA per channel). Selection among LM258 variants depends on specific input offset voltage and output current requirements.
Low-Power Alternative:
The LM2904AVQPWR (Texas Instruments, Active status) reduces supply current to 500µA (compared to 600µA in the LM358WPT) while maintaining identical input bias current, input offset voltage, and output current specifications. This device supports extended temperature operation (-40°C to 125°C) and is suitable for power-constrained applications.
High-Performance JFET Input Alternative:
The TL062IPWR (Texas Instruments, Active status) employs J-FET input architecture, delivering significantly lower input bias current (30pA versus 20nA) and higher slew rate (3.5V/µs). However, this device requires a minimum 10V supply voltage and delivers only 20mA output current per channel, making it suitable only for applications where these specifications align with system requirements.
Package Consideration:
The LM358DMR2G (onsemi, Active status) utilizes an 8-MSOP package (0.118" width) rather than the standard 8-TSSOP (0.173" width). This package variant is not directly interchangeable on existing PCBs designed for 8-TSSOP footprints and should be selected only when PCB redesign is feasible.
Discontinued Status:
The LM2904AVQPWRG4 (Texas Instruments) is marked as discontinued at DiGi Electronics and should not be selected for new designs despite meeting electrical specifications.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Can I directly replace the LM358WPT with any of the listed substitute parts?
A: Direct replacement on existing PCBs is possible only with parts using the identical 8-TSSOP package (0.173" width). The LM358DMR2G uses an 8-MSOP package and is not pin-compatible. All other listed substitutes use the standard 8-TSSOP package and are physically interchangeable. Electrical compatibility must be verified against specific application requirements.
Q: What is the primary reason to replace the LM358WPT?
A: The LM358WPT carries a "Not For New Designs" product status. For new circuit development, the LM2904PT provides identical electrical performance with active product status. For applications requiring enhanced bandwidth and slew rate, the LM258 series offers superior performance while maintaining backward compatibility.
Q: Does the LM258 series provide better performance than the LM358WPT?
A: Yes. The LM258 series (LM258PT, LM258WPT, LM258WYPT, LM258YPT, LM258APT) delivers 0.6V/µs slew rate and 1.1MHz gain-bandwidth product compared to the LM358WPT's 0.3V/µs and 800kHz. These improvements enable faster signal processing and higher-frequency operation. Input bias current remains identical at 20nA, ensuring equivalent input impedance.
Q: Are there supply voltage compatibility concerns with substitute parts?
A: The LM358WPT supports 3V to 32V operation. Most substitutes support 3V to 30V, which is compatible for applications not exceeding 30V. The TL062IPWR requires a minimum 10V supply and is not suitable for 3V to 10V applications. Verify the specific supply voltage range of your application before selection.
Q: What is the difference between LM258WPT and LM258WYPT?
A: Both devices share identical electrical specifications: 0.6V/µs slew rate, 1.1MHz gain-bandwidth product, 2mV input offset voltage, and 60mA output current per channel. The suffix variation indicates different manufacturing or qualification batches. Both are active products with AEC-Q100 automotive qualification and are functionally equivalent.
Q: Why does the TL062IPWR have such low input bias current?
A: The TL062IPWR employs J-FET input architecture, which inherently produces lower input bias current (30pA) compared to bipolar input designs (20nA in the LM358WPT). This characteristic makes the TL062IPWR suitable for high-impedance signal sources. However, the J-FET design requires higher minimum supply voltage (10V) and provides lower output current (20mA per channel).
Q: Can I use the LM358DMR2G as a direct replacement?
A: The LM358DMR2G is not a direct PCB replacement due to its 8-MSOP package (0.118" width) versus the LM358WPT's 8-TSSOP package (0.173" width). These packages have different pinout footprints. The LM358DMR2G is suitable only if PCB redesign is performed. Additionally, this device operates only from 0°C to 70°C, which is a narrower temperature range than the LM358WPT.
Q: What does AEC-Q100 qualification mean?
A: AEC-Q100 is an automotive electronics qualification standard. Devices carrying this qualification (LM258 series variants) have undergone rigorous testing for automotive applications, including temperature cycling, vibration, and reliability assessments. This qualification is relevant only if your application requires automotive-grade components.
Q: Is the LM2904AVQPWRG4 available for new designs?
A: No. The LM2904AVQPWRG4 is marked as discontinued at DiGi Electronics. For new designs requiring the LM2904 electrical characteristics, select the LM2904AVQPWR (active status) instead.
